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d. (RCL) traded at $259.14, down 0.45% in the latest session, as the stock continued to consolidate just below a key resistance level of $272.1. The price remains well above its established support at $246.18, suggesting a balanced but cautious near-term posture.

In the most recent trading session, Royal Caribbean shares experienced a modest decline of 0.45%, closing at $259.14. The move came on trading volume that hovered near its recent average, indicating that the pullback lacked aggressive selling pressure. The broader cruise sector has faced headwinds from mixed economic data and fluctuating consumer sentiment, with peers such as Carnival and Norwegian also showing slight weakness during the period. Investors appeared to weigh ongoing travel demand against rising operational costs, including fuel and labor. The current price action suggests that market participants are digesting recent industry trends and awaiting further catalysts, such as upcoming earnings reports or shifts in travel booking patterns. The stock’s positioning relative to its sector peers remains competitive, but the lack of a decisive breakout above resistance has kept momentum in check. Overall, the session reflected a period of consolidation rather than a directional shift, with the stock trading within a narrow range between support and resistance levels. The slight negative move may indicate that traders are taking profits after recent gains, though no clear catalyst for the decline was evident in the data. From a technical perspective, Royal Caribbean’s price action is unfolding within a well-defined range, with support at $246.18 and resistance at $272.1. The stock’s recent close near $259.14 places it roughly midway between these two levels, suggesting an equilibrium between buyers and sellers. The price is trading slightly below its 50-day moving average, a level that often acts as a short-term trend guide.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) appears to be in neutral territory, likely in the mid-40s to mid-50s, indicating that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) histogram may be showing signs of flattening, hinting at a potential pause in upward momentum. Candlestick patterns during the session did not reveal any clear reversal signals; instead, the stock formed a small-bodied candle, typical of indecision. The current consolidation pattern could be interpreted as a bearish flag if a breakdown occurs, or as a bull flag if the stock eventually pushes above resistance. Volume has not confirmed any breakout, so the technical setup remains neutral. The $246.18 support level has been tested multiple times in recent months, providing a solid floor, while the $272.1 resistance has capped rallies. Looking ahead, Royal Caribbean’s trajectory may depend on a combination of company-specific and macroeconomic factors. If the stock manages to hold above the $246.18 support, it could attempt a move toward the $272.1 resistance zone. A breakout above that level might open the door to further upside, potentially targeting the psychological $280 area. Conversely, a sustained break below support could trigger a retest of lower levels, possibly around $235. Key catalysts that could influence the direction include upcoming earnings announcements, changes in travel demand data, and shifts in fuel costs or interest rates. The broader market environment, particularly consumer discretionary spending, will also play a role. Any positive surprises in booking trends or cost management could provide a boost, while negative economic data might weigh on sentiment. Traders may watch for volume confirmation on any break of the current range. The stock’s ability to stage a recovery from the slight decline may hinge on sector momentum and investor appetite for travel-related equities.
